Toughing up your home decor is a style that advocates for the absentminded, harsh edges, and functionality. Emerging from the industrial revolution, this decor style modifies utilitarian items used in factories into glamorous home items. 

One of them is defined by exposed materials, neutral colors, and the combination of the old and the new, such as in industrial and minimalism

In this blog, I will focus on describing the characteristics of the industrial home decor furniture, what kind of furniture pieces define this style, and how to decorate the house using the industrial furniture. 

The following are the characteristics of the Industrial Home Decor Furniture

characteristics of the Industrial Home Decor Furniture

  • Exposed Materials: The raw and unfinished materials are more often used in Industrial furniture. These features include use of exposed brick walls and wooden beams, concrete floor, and exposed ductwork. Even if it is a chair, the screws, rivets and even welding marks on the furniture may intentionally be left exposed to lend the product an extremely utilitarian look. 
  • Neutral Color Palette: The tones in industrial style are primarily settled in the black and white color and also the shades of gray. These are usually accented with natural wood-like and metal sheens
  • Utilitarian Design: All the industrial furniture reflects functionality as is the central idea behind the furniture design. An item is usually a tribute to old factory or laboratory furniture and the aesthetics of functional simplicity overshadows ornamentation. 
  • Reclaimed and Repurposed Materials: Applying recycled wood, metal, and other mediums is another characteristic of industrial furniture. This also enhances the rugged look while at the same time increasing the part’s durability as it is reusable. 

Secure types of home decor industrial furniture

Secure types of home decor industrial furniture

  • Industrial Tables: Dining, coffee, or side industrial tables have a solid wooden top with metal legs. In some cases, it can be raw; sometimes the wood is reclaimed or distressed; also the metal might be raw or distressed to give it that antique look. 
  • Industrial Chairs and Stools: The references to chairs and stools in the given industrial theme are typically constructed of metal and wood. There are many preferences among which it is possible to single out bar stools with metal bases and wooden seats. Other pieces for a vintage office also include the leather executive office chairs that have a metallic frame to match with the decor style.
  • Industrial Shelving and Storage: Metal piping is also used in the industrial types of shelving units and storage solutions where wooden shelves are placed on the pipes. Such items can be utilitarian as well as serve aesthetic purposes and make the architecture of a room more interesting. 
  • Industrial Lighting: One of the critical aspects of interior design of industrial spaces is lighting. Fitted with bare bulbs, metallic housings, and swan necks are typical. Another extraordinary ambition is achieved by floor lamps with metal stands and large acrylic lampshades. 
  • Industrial Sofas and Armchairs: If the style of the piece is more industrial then the plastics used are more likely to be distressed leather and the backrest and armrests of sofa and armchairs are more likely to be made with steel. The frames can be conspicuous and may be made of wood or metal while the designs are typically stocky and the product has a defined simplicity. 

Few Steps to Industrial Furniture for Your Home

Few Steps to Industrial Furniture for Your Home

  • Mix with Other Styles: One of the greatest uses of industrial furniture is that furniture can be used in almost any setting. It can also be combined with other design styles like the modern style or the rustic style to come up with a preferred design. For instance, an industrial coffee table is contrasting with a modern and sleek sofa, and will therefore do great together. 
  • Focus on Functionality: This is the best time to remember that functionality forms the basis of industrial design. Select furniture pieces which are fashionable but functional also. For instance, an industrial shelving unit can be a shelf in a factory and at the same time it can be a cupboard. 
  • Instead use neutral colors: Avoid going for a mix of colors, which will mar the overall theme of the room. All the dominant colors which are blacks, whites, grays, and browns should be allowed to take prominence with splashes of color only coming from accessories and trinkets.
  • Incorporate Metal and Wood: Combination of metals and wood will ensure the concept of industrial style is achieved within the space. For instance, a wooden dining table accompanied with metal chairs will offer an excellent industrial theme. 
  • Add Vintage Elements: Introduce retro features to intensify the utilization of the industrial look. This could be an ancient factory cart converted to a coffee table or metal lockers converted to a store. 
  • Focus on Open Spaces: I was able to conclude that industrial themes are perfect for large spaces. To promote an openness you should reduce the amount of clutter present in the home and avoid serious furnishing of the home. 
  • Experiment with Lighting: Industrial lighting can be a boon or bane to the industrial style chosen for the home. Choose lighting fixtures such as the pendant lights that have exposed bulbs, the floor lamps which creatively resemble the lamps of the vintage era and the wall sconces that have metal type of shades.
